Fintech Powerhouse Flutterwave Unites with Polygon to Ignite Stablecoin Payment Revolution
Nigeria's leading fintech company, Flutterwave, has officially partnered with Polygon Labs to introduce a pioneering stablecoin-powered cross-border payment network. This ambitious initiative, announced on November 2, 2025, aims to revolutionize international transactions across 34 African countries, making them significantly faster and more affordable for users.
The new system is designed to leverage Polygon's robust Ethereum-compatible infrastructure, which will serve as the backbone for the network. By utilizing stablecoins such as USDT and USDC, the platform will bypass traditional banking intermediaries, directly addressing two of Africa's most persistent financial challenges: the slowness of cross-border transfers and the high costs associated with remittances. Flutterwave CEO Olugbenga Agboola anticipates that this strategic move could potentially increase the company's payment volumes tenfold.
This partnership arrives at a pivotal moment when blockchain adoption is rapidly accelerating across the African continent. Factors such as inflationary pressures and currency devaluations, particularly in countries like Nigeria, are driving a surge in demand for more stable and efficient financial solutions. A 2024 report by Chainalysis underscored the economic benefits of stablecoin remittances, finding them approximately 60% cheaper than conventional $200 transfers to Africa.
Flutterwave has been strategically positioning itself within the blockchain space, with previous moves including joining the Circle Payment Network and forging a partnership with Hedera to enable USDC settlements. These actions signal a clear strategic shift towards integrating blockchain-based infrastructure into its core operations, enhancing liquidity and transaction efficiency.
The collaboration between Flutterwave and Polygon Labs not only places Flutterwave at the forefront of Africa's emerging blockchain-driven payments ecosystem but also expands Polygon's footprint into real-world financial applications beyond its traditional crypto-native markets. With major global firms like Mastercard, Visa, and Western Union also exploring stablecoin integration, Africa is rapidly becoming a vital testbed for global digital finance innovation.
If successful, the Flutterwave-Polygon platform has the potential to establish new benchmarks for interoperability and regulatory engagement within the digital finance landscape. It offers a compelling glimpse into how stablecoins could underpin future payment infrastructure across frontier economies, ultimately helping to connect African markets to global capital flows in real-time and fundamentally reshaping how money moves across the continent.
